What's marijuana?
Cannabis is often a plant more effectively called cannabis sativa. As talked about, some cannabis sativa vegetation do not need abuse probable and they are called hemp. Hemp is utilized broadly for a variety of fiber solutions together with newspaper and artist's canvas. Cannabis sativa with abuse potential is what we get in touch with marijuana (Doweiko, 2009). It truly is appealing to notice that Despite the fact that broadly scientific tests for quite some time, there is a lot that researchers nevertheless have no idea about marijuana. Neuroscientists and biologists really know what the results of cannabis are Nonetheless they continue to never fully understand why (Hazelden, 2005).

Deweiko (2009), Gold, Frost-Pineda, & Jacobs (2004) point out that of roughly four hundred identified chemical substances located in the cannabis plants, researchers know of above sixty which might be considered to acquire psychoactive outcomes to the human Mind. Quite possibly the most famous and strong of such is ∆-nine-tetrahydrocannabinol, or THC. Like Hazelden (2005), Deweiko states that though We all know a lot of the neurophysical consequences of THC, The explanations THC generates these outcomes pre rolled joints worldwide shipping are unclear.

Neurobiology:
As a psychoactive material, THC right influences the central nervous program (CNS). It impacts an enormous array of neurotransmitters and catalyzes other biochemical and enzymatic action too. The CNS is stimulated once the THC activates particular neuroreceptors within the brain creating the various physical and psychological reactions that should be expounded on extra specifically even further on. The only substances that may activate neurotransmitters are substances that mimic chemicals that the Mind provides Obviously. The point that THC stimulates Mind operate teaches researchers that the brain has natural cannabinoid receptors. It remains unclear why individuals have pure cannabinoid receptors And just how they operate (Hazelden, 2005; Martin, 2004). What we do know is marijuana will stimulate cannabinoid receptors nearly 20 periods far more actively than any of your body's all-natural neurotransmitters ever could (Doweiko, 2009).

Perhaps the most significant secret of all is the connection among THC and also the neurotransmitter serotonin. Serotonin receptors are among the most stimulated by all psychoactive prescription drugs, but most specially Liquor and nicotine. Impartial of marijuana's relationship While using the chemical, serotonin is by now somewhat understood neurochemical and its supposed neuroscientific roles of performing and reason are still mainly hypothetical (Schuckit & Tapert, 2004). What neuroscientists have found definitively is usually that cannabis people who smoke have extremely higher amounts of serotonin action (Hazelden, 2005). Apparently, marijuana mimics so many neurological reactions of other prescription drugs that it is incredibly hard to classify in a selected course. Researchers will put it in any of these types: psychedelic; hallucinogen; or serotonin inhibitor. It's properties that mimic very similar chemical responses as opioids. Other chemical responses mimic stimulants (Ashton, 2001; Gold, Frost-Pineda, & Jacobs, 2004). Hazelden (2005) classifies marijuana in its own Exclusive class - cannabinoids. The reason for this confusion could be the complexity of the various psychoactive Attributes located inside cannabis, equally recognized and not known.
